I hope this doesn’t sound rude/harsh but currently you have the insane running the asylum. You keep looking for rational behaviour from your son who is mired in addiction. It is just not possible for him to see this until he feels pain and consequences.

We all do it. Keep trying to find that magic word or piece of advice where they finally see and admit what they are doing is self destructive. We can see it as clear as day… why can’t they?

Maybe it’s time for you and your wife to reclaim your lives. It is very hard on a marriage and addiction just loves to divide and conquer… create lots of chaos so that the attention is off the addiction.
